Air India Express sacks 25 employees day after ‘mass sick leaves' calls ‘unprofessional behaviour’

  • The Air India Express on May 09 terminated around 25 cabin crew who reported 'sick' and didn't report to work. As per sources, the management terminated cabin crew members due to their ‘unprofessional behaviour’. The mass sick leave was considered a pre-meditated and concerted abstention from work without justifiable reason. The disruption caused by the mass sick leave affected more than 95+ flights of Air India Express between May 07, 08. Air India Express CEO, Aloke Singh also announced plans to reduce flight operations in the coming days.
